Top online company, Jadestone is growing with the fast pace of technology as it brings Scarab to the iPhone. Jadestone began in 2002 as it tried to capture the European market. Based out of Sweden, Jadestone has created many multiplayer games dating as far back as 1999.
Since that time, Jadestone has focused on browser-based sports games, new online game platforms and as of recently mobile games. Now, Scarab Solitaire has been the latest release from this company for their mobile arena.
Scarab Solitaire is an online Egyptian themed game similar to classic solitaire. This game has made its popularity through popular online social networks such as facebook. After launching in these arenas, Scarab Solitaire has become one of the most popular online games. In the past six months, this game has been played approximately 30 million times.
“With the iPhone’s increasing importance as a gaming device, it was practically a given that we’d get involved,” said Tommy Palm, Vice President Mobile at Jadestone. “We were interested in seeing how we could reinvent one of our most successful casual games for the iPhone and iPod Touch. We’re very pleased with the result. Not only does the touch screen get you closer to the action, we were also able to add real 3D animations and let players choose their own music.”
Now the iPhone has added this game to its already extensive arsenal of games. It can be purchased through the iTunes store for $1.99. People around the globe can enjoy this game as it is also available in English, German, French, Spanish or Italian.
